Just an update on my CBT exam, just finished it today. When I my checked Pearson Vue, the status of my exam was "Pass", I was half-excited, I know this is not the confirmatory result, but it gave me hope that my exam went kinda well =)(Please tell me that "Pass" meant i passed the test =|). Going to the exam questions, most are NMC codes and situational questions. What surprised me was how many of the questions were from Royal Marsden practice test (around 15 items) and i mean word-for-word and some from NMC Code(around 15), the rest are from various nursing practice/nursing process/clinical skills assessment etc. (if you want specifics, ill have my email below to give you some details). The first 70 questions gave me an easy feel and that's when i started to panic, because the reamianing questions started to feel tricky (or i was just starting to freak out and starts overthinking lol), i managed to finish in a little over 2 hours, but just like what a friend advised me, always REVIEW your answers (this is when i realised that i had 3 answers wrong the first time, i checked the answers after exam =D), btw you can flag questions so you can get back to them when its time to review.A piece of advise, take your time, focus on the options that would best benefit the patient and read on British health trend that we dont practice in other country.

Hi! To those who have received their DLs or are already in the assessment queue, were you notified by the nmc that you were already in the queue?

NMC normally don't inform candidates that they are in the assessment queue already. You'd have to go out of your way and contact (phone/email) them for them to tell you.

Hello.

for those who have received their DL already, regarding the reference form particularly on section 2: referee's detail, did your referee wrote their own phone number anf email address on the alloted column or just the phone number and email address of the hospital?

Should they write their own number or the hospital phone number.

thank you.

They should put in the number and email address that they regularly use, regardless of whether those are home, work, or personal details. The point of putting those in is so NMC can easily contact them in case they have any questions regarding the candidates and their credentials.

In short, they should write in contact details that give NMC the best chance of being able to reach them at any given time.

Hi. I already submitted my documents to NMC. How will I know if NMC uploaded the documents in the portal? Will it be reflected on my profile?

Hi. Usually, it takes 10-15 days for NMC to upload barcoded forms from the day they received the documents in their office. You just have to check your portal every now and then to see if those forms have been uploaded on your portal. Also, always check your emails for any feedback. it is tiresome but it is the best thing to do especially now that NMC is receiving a lot of applicants. I did that for 67 calendar days. Hahaha
